Many factors can lead to the derailment of a train There are many factors that can cause a train to derail, including:

Track problems: If there's an issue with the condition of the tracks such as broken rails or loose ties, it could cause the train to slide off.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ent these kinds of issues.

Failure of the equipment: Mechanical issues with the train's bearings or wheels could cause a train to derail. It is essential that train companies conduct regular inspections and maintenance on their trains.

Human error: Train engineers and other railway workers could make mistakes that result in an accident that causes a derailment. For example the case where an employee is distracted on their phone while operating the train, or they fail to slow down when turning at an intersection and cause an accident that could lead to a derailment.
